Introduction: The Growing Role of Small Businesses in the UK Economy
Small businesses are at the heart of the UK economy. They make up more than 99% of private sector firms and play a vital role in driving innovation, employment, and community growth. But in today’s fast-paced marketplace, success depends on more than having a good product. Customers also expect efficiency, transparency, and speed in how that product reaches them.
For many small businesses, this is where reliable courier services prove essential.

The Challenges Small Businesses Face Today
Rising customer expectations for fast delivery
Online shopping has changed the way people buy. Next-day delivery and order tracking are now standard expectations. Competing with these standards can be tough for smaller businesses without professional delivery support.
Limited resources and logistics expertise
Running a small business often means working with tight budgets and lean teams. Setting up an in-house delivery system requires vehicles, drivers, insurance, and technology- costs that can be difficult to manage.
Navigating post-Brexit supply chain issues
Brexit has brought new customs rules, paperwork, and added complexity to international trade. Small businesses that want to grow overseas often need expert support to make the process smoother.
Why Courier Services Are Essential for Small Businesses
Speed and reliability in deliveries
A dependable courier ensures that products reach customers on time. Fast, accurate deliveries mean fewer complaints, more repeat business, and positive customer reviews.
Building customer trust and loyalty
When customers can rely on clear tracking updates and consistent delivery times, they’re more likely to return and recommend your business to others.
Supporting cross-border trade
International sales can be a powerful growth opportunity, but they require knowledge of customs and shipping processes. Courier services with global networks make it easier for small businesses to reach new markets with confidence.
The Benefits of Partnering with a Professional Courier Service
Cost efficiency compared to in-house logistics
Instead of managing vehicles, staff, and overhead costs, small businesses can use the resources of an established courier partner. This keeps delivery affordable and efficient.
Access to global delivery networks
Courier companies already have the infrastructure and connections to deliver both locally and internationally, helping small businesses expand their reach.
Scalable solutions that grow with your business
As businesses grow, their delivery needs change. A professional courier partner can scale services up or down, making it easier to handle seasonal peaks or steady long-term growth.
Choosing the Right Courier Partner
What to look for in service reliability
Delivery times, success rates, and customer reviews are important measures of whether a courier partner can be trusted.
The importance of customer support
Having a responsive courier partner makes all the difference when challenges arise. Strong communication helps businesses stay in control and reassures customers.
Technology and tracking transparency
A courier service that offers online booking, digital tracking, and proactive updates creates a smoother experience for both businesses and their customers.

What’s the difference between a courier and freight forwarder?
A courier typically manages smaller, time-sensitive parcels, while a freight forwarder handles larger shipments across sea, air, or land.
